Built in the Chainguard Factory, Chainguard VMs benefit from a highly automated, secure-by-design build pipeline that ensures consistent, reproducible artifacts.</description></item><item><title>Chainguard VMs Compliance Features</title><link>https://deploy-preview-3155--ornate-narwhal-088216.netlify.app/chainguard/vms/compliance-features/</link><pubDate>Thu, 20 Nov 2025 08:04:00 +0000</pubDate><guid>https://deploy-preview-3155--ornate-narwhal-088216.netlify.app/chainguard/vms/compliance-features/</guid><description>Chainguard VMs provide pre-hardened, audit-ready Linux virtual machine images designed for regulated and high-assurance environments (federal, defense, healthcare, financial services, and suppliers to those sectors). These images combine the following features:
Feature Description FIPS 140-3 validated cryptography NIST CMVP-validated software modules and SP 800-90B compliant entropy, with runtime guardrails blocking non-FIPS crypto. STIG hardening Pre-configured to DISA STIG controls, delivered as production-ready images. CIS benchmark compliance CIS Level 1 hardened variants, hybrid STIG + CIS baseline.</description></item><item><title>Chainguard VMs FAQ</title><link>https://deploy-preview-3155--ornate-narwhal-088216.netlify.app/chainguard/vms/faq/</link><pubDate>Tue, 21 Oct 2025 08:04:00 +0000</pubDate><guid>https://deploy-preview-3155--ornate-narwhal-088216.netlify.app/chainguard/vms/faq/</guid><description>Which platforms and hypervisors are Chainguard VMs available for? Chainguard VMs are available for AWS (EC2 and ECS/EKS), GCP (Compute Engine), and Azure Compute cloud environments, and also for on-prem solutions based on KVM such as QEmu, VMWare, Nutanix, among others.
What kinds of VMs are currently available? As part of our initial offering, we’re providing Container Host VMs, Base VMs, and Application VMs. This list should expand as we fine tune the product based on customer feedback.</description></item></channel></rss>
